DENVER – This is the beginning of the wedding season in Colorado, but with the huge snowstorm in the forecast, many brides who had dreamed of outdoor weddings, are now scrambling to figure something else out.

Chelsea Tolle had planned to get married at an outdoors gazebo at Stonebrook Manor in Thornton. But she was there on Thursday getting a tour of the indoor options.

“I also get weather alerts on my cell phone, and the other night I started getting them at 4 in the morning saying we’re under a winter weather watch. I’m like oh my goodness. So i kind of got a little freaked out,” Tolle said.

She decided to move the whole thing inside, and is glad she had that option. She says she’s disappointed, but still excited.

“As long as we get married that’s all the matters,” she said.
